1 stick unsalted butter
1 tablespoon ground cayenne pepper
1 tablespoon ground black pepper
1 tablespoon ground white pepper
1 tablespoon salt
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
6 - 8 boneless, skinless chicken breast halves
6 - 8 medium wooden skewers
Melt butter in a small bowl in the microwave (covered). Stir in all spices.
Cut chicken into big chunks and put five or six chunks on each skewer. Brush with a little of the pepper butter. Grill 6 - 8 minutes, turning, or until chicken is done. Place on serving platter and drizzle with more pepper butter (you don't necessarily have to use all of it). Serve with maybe fruit salad and sourdough bread. Or a creamy potato salad and some tomatoes.
Notes: I have made smaller kabobs and served them as hor d'oeuvres at parties and they're always the first to go. Also, it's a good idea to soak the wooden skewers in water for an hour or two so they don't burn as much on the grill.
